NEW PROVIDENCE -- What ghosts roam within
the historic sites and buildings of Central N.J.? How accurate
are the traditional stories?
On Sunday, Nov. 9, at 3 p.m. at the New Providence
Memorial Library all are invited to hear answers to these
questions and more about haunted New Jersey.
Garrett Husveth, a court-approved forensic
examiner, will present a talk about "Historic Haunts
of Central New Jersey," which is also the title of his
recently-published book. From the shadowed woods of the Somerset
Hills to the dappled banks of the Delaware River, Mr. Husveth
will deliver a rich mix of factual history and the sound investigation
of ghostly phenomena.
For the last 22 years, Mr. Husveth's hobby has been investigating
paranormal phenomena throughout the U. S., but specifically
in New Jersey and Pennsylvania. He is co-starring in a new
network series dealing with the paranormal, which will start
airing in January 2009. Mr. Husveth is a co-founder of hauntednewjersey.com
and the Northeast Regional Coordinator for the American Association
of Electronic Voice Phenomena, and a founding member of Parapsychologist
Loyd Auerback's Paranormal Research Organization (PROs), an
invitation-only organization of parapsychologists, paranormal
investigators, scientists and intuitives in North America.
